Linux中已弃用功能全解析

linux deprecated

时间:2024-12-02 04:23


Linux:面对“弃用”标签的顽强生命力与未来展望 在科技日新月异的今天,操作系统作为计算机技术的基石,其每一次迭代和变革都牵动着整个行业的神经

    Linux,这个自1991年由林纳斯·托瓦兹(Linus Torvalds)创建的开源操作系统,经过数十年的发展,已经在服务器、嵌入式设备、云计算以及超级计算机等多个领域占据了举足轻重的地位

    然而,近年来,随着新技术的不断涌现和旧有技术的逐渐淘汰,“Linux弃用”(Linux deprecated)这一说法开始在某些技术社区和媒体上出现,引发了广泛的讨论和关注

     一、Linux“弃用”现象的背景与解读 首先,我们需要明确的是,“弃用”(deprecated)在编程和软件开发的语境中,通常指的是某个功能、方法或技术虽然目前仍然可用,但已经不再推荐使用,并且在未来的版本更新中可能会被移除或替换

    在Linux的上下文中,“弃用”可能涉及到内核中的某些特性、API调用、工具或命令等

     Linux作为一个持续演进的项目,其内核和配套工具的不断更新是常态

    在这个过程中,一些过时的、低效的或存在安全风险的特性被标记为“弃用”,是技术进步的必然结果

    例如,随着安全意识的提升,一些旧的加密算法和协议被新的、更安全的方案所取代;随着硬件技术的发展,一些针对老旧硬件的优化和支持也逐渐变得不必要

     然而,值得注意的是,“弃用”并不等同于“废弃”或“消亡”

    Linux社区在处理“弃用”问题时,通常会给予充分的过渡期,让开发者有时间适应新的技术和标准

    同时,Linux的开源特性也意味着,即使某些特性在官方版本中被移除,它们仍然可以在社区维护的分支或衍生版本中继